Which airport should I fly into?

Recommended Airport

Washington Dulles International Airport (IAD)

  • Approximately 10 minutes from the conference venue

  • Best option for convenience

  • Domestic and international flights

  • Rental cars, Uber, Lyft, taxis, and shuttle services available

Alternative Airport

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A)

  • Approximately 30–40 minutes from the conference venue (traffic dependent)

  • Excellent option for domestic flights

  • Often offers additional airline choices and competitive airfare

  • Metro, rideshare services, taxis, and rental cars available

Is parking available?

Yes.

Complimentary on-site self-parking is available for all conference attendees at the Westfields Marriott throughout the conference.

There is no additional charge to park during the event.
